Whenever your vehicle slows down, it has to overcome, or dissipate, its kinetic energy.

Normally, you accomplish this through the brakes: your car's kinetic energy turns into heat energy from the friction of your brakes. That's why braking distance increases exponentially as speed increases—twice the speed means four times the braking distance.

Kinetic energy is the energy possessed by an object because of the motion carried out or experienced. All moving objects, certainly have kinetic energy. Kinetic energy is also called motion energy. Kinetic energy is influenced by the mass and velocity of an object as it moves. The mass is symbolized by the letter m, while the speed is symbolized by the letter v. The amount of energy is directly proportional to the amount of mass and the magnitude of the speed of an object when moving.

Objects with large mass and velocity must have large kinetic energy when moving. Vice versa, objects with mass and velocity are small, kinetic energy is also small.

Examples of kinetic energy are trucks that move, when you run, and various other movements.

Another example you can also observe when you throw a stone. The stone you throw must have speed, and therefore it has kinetic energy. The kinetic energy of this stone you can see the impact when it hits the target in front of it.

KINETIC ENERGY FORMULA

Kinetic energy is influenced by the mass (m) and velocity (v) of an object. If an object with mass m moves at velocity v, it can be said that the object has a kinetic energy of:

Ek = 1/2. mv2

Information:

Ek: Kinetic Energy

m: a mass of objects

v: object speed

People have stages of moral reasoning. The answers to the questions are below.

The primary focus in the conventional level of Kohlberg's theory is aim to please and seek the approval of others people. It is known to be based on the acceptance of social standards of right and wrong.

<h3>The two stages of the conventional level </h3>
  • Stage 3\; in this second level is referred to as good boy/good girl stage. People under  or in this stage often view behaviors as right or wrong by their influence on social relationships.

  • Stage 4: This is referred to as the law and order stage. In this stage, people view or judge behaviors as right or wrong using rules established in society.
